一 | The UK government has rolled out the Energy Bills Support Scheme, under which British households will start receiving £400 ($488) off their energy bills from October, with the discount made in six instalments to help families throughout the winter period.,However, the measure does not seem to be enough to save the day, given that Brits have found themselves caught between nearly two-digit inflation and soaring mortgage payments, according to Rodney Atkinson, an academic and political and economic commentator.,"Once the government lost control of monetary policy (or indeed deliberately printed money during COVID in order to debase its own debt) then there are no easy ways out," Atkinson said. "The British government has offered all households energy subsidies and those on support programs more. But now interest rates are rising and although this raises the value of the pound and reduces import and energy costs, the overall effect is more suffering. Mortgage costs and business debt costs have been rising for months.",Increasing energy bills all across Europe are whipping inflation up even further. The Boyapati Srinu directorial may face a litmus test at the ticket window, and as expected, Akhanda 2 underperformed on the first Monday. The film reportedly collected Rs 5.1 crore on the fourth day, taking the overall tally of film’s collections to Rs 66 crore (net) in India. So far, the film’s strong weekend performance underlines Balakrishna’s massive fan following and his ability to pull audiences to theatres. But Akhanda 2 fumbled on its first Monday, nearly completing its major theatrical run. As a result, Balakrishna had reportedly shifted focus on to his next ambitious project. Balakrishna to turn singer Balakrishna reunites with director Gopichand Malineni, marking their second outing together after delivering a successful Veera Simha Reddy earlier in 2023. This time, the duo is stepping into a completely different zone, as the upcoming project is said to be a grand period drama. The film promises to showcase Balakrishna in a powerful and regal avatar, backed by a rich narrative and large-scale presentation. Adding to the excitement, Nayanthara has been finalized as the female lead, making this pairing one of the most talked-about combinations in recent times. Her presence is expected to bring both star value and emotional depth to the story. According to industry buzz, Balakrishna will also be lending his voice for a special song in the film, a move that has already generated excitement among fans. Grand sets under construction Balakrishna-Gopichand film is being mounted on a massive scale, with special grand sets currently being built to recreate the period setting. From lavish sets to detailed costumes and grand action sequences, the film aims to be a visual spectacle. With a reported budget exceeding Rs 100 crore, the makers are leaving no stone unturned to ensure high production values. With Akhanda 2 turning out to be a disappointing outing, Balakrishna is determined to strike back at the box office with vengeance.
